A Deed of Gift, is a deed that transfers a title to real property from one party (the Grantor/Donor) to another (the Grantee/Donee). You will usually see a deed of gift being used to voluntarily transfer property between family members or close friends. They can also be utilized to donate the property to a charity or nonprofit ...

The most common type of deed is a general warranty … WebBargain and Sale Deed. A bargain and sale deed in Washington would be called a special warranty deed in many other states. By using a bargain and sale deed, the grantor makes some promises regarding title, but the covenants only relate to the period that the grantor owned the property. Thus, the grantor promises (1) that he or she is the owner ...
